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Brighton Sober | Burnet Rose Rust |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Fungi (Fungi)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Basidiomycota (Club Fungi)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Pucciniomycetes (Pucciniomycetes)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Pucciniales (Pucciniales) |
| Family | Gelechiidae | Phragmidiaceae |
| Genus | Aproaerema | Phragmidium |
| Species | Aproaerema vinella | Phragmidium rosae-pimpinellifoliae |
